Apache kafka 卡夫卡主题创建命令

Apache kafka 卡夫卡主题创建命令,apache-kafka,Apache Kafka,我指的是一本关于卡夫卡的书。要创建卡夫卡主题,它声明: 使用命令行实用程序在Kafka服务器上创建主题,让我们创建一个名为replicated kafkatopic的主题,该主题包含两个分区和两个副本: kafka-topics.sh--create--zookeeper localhost:2181--replication factor 3--partitions 1--topic replicated kafkatopic 虽然文本声明创建2个分区和2个副本,但传递的参数是:3表示复制因子

我指的是一本关于卡夫卡的书。要创建卡夫卡主题,它声明:

使用命令行实用程序在Kafka服务器上创建主题,让我们创建一个名为replicated kafkatopic的主题,该主题包含两个分区和两个副本:

kafka-topics.sh--create--zookeeper localhost:2181--replication factor 3--partitions 1--topic replicated kafkatopic

虽然文本声明创建2个分区和2个副本,但传递的参数是:3表示复制因子,1表示分区


在文本所述的上下文中,参数是否正确?

否,必须是打字错误。如果要创建包含两个分区和两个副本的主题,命令应如下所示:

k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 2 --partitions 2 --topic replicated-kafkatopic
您提供的命令创建了一个主题
replicated kafkatopic
,其中包含1个分区(
--partitions 1
)和3个副本(
--replication factor 3